I have no problem at all with Zappos but I do with these boots. I have been wearing Dr. Martens religiously for almost thirty years. These model boots for almost 15. It's a real shame that their quality has really gone to crap. This is the second pair in a row that the leather has split and ripped open on the inside of each boot where the bottom of the inside lace area meets the toe section. I'm not just talking about a small split or tear. I'm talking like over a 1" rip right through to the inside. This is the second pair its happened to and within 4 months of purchase. I used to be able to wear these boots and other Dr. Martens boots until the bottoms wore off practically. I will be contacting Dr. Martens directly as well and probably will discontinue wearing their products. I hate to do it but I will no longer pay this much for garbage.

I've owned a lot of Doc's but I tell you in the last five years the quality of these boots have gone down hill dramatically, I used to get three years out of a set of work boots I'm lucky to get just over a year out of the last two pairs I've owned! Very disappointing I still have a pair that are 15 years old that hold out better than my new ones. The last pair I had of these the soles split from from the shoes same with the last pair very sad for this company to fall so far so fast! I just switched to Red Wing work boots let see how well they work. I tried to stay with these boots but failed two times in the past two years, if you're looking for a boot that looks good but can't take any normal abuse buy them, if you want a work boot go somewhere else.
